General approach to suspected poisoning in children

In 2017, Czech Toxicological Information Center (TIC) provided 9 621 consultations concerning intoxications or exposures to hazardoussubstances, mixtures, and products in the patients under 18 years of age. The most common cause was the drug intoxication.Poisoning in children under the age of 5 years most frequently happened accidentally. In adolescents, poisonings occurredmainly due to suicide attempts. Severe intoxications of infants, toddlers, and preschoolers were rare. Important elements of thediagnostics of poisoning are: relevant medical history, physical examination, laboratory and X-ray methods and consultationwith TIC. In case of exposure to a toxic dose of hazardous substances, primary decontamination should be performed as earlyas possible. Specific antidotes and enhanced elimination methods are applied if indicated in severe cases. Supportive care is ofutmost importance. Intoxications in children could be prevented in most cases. Health care personnel can efficiently promoteprevention with educational campaigns focused on the parents.
